Damage from record flooding in Washington state is profound, with more on the way, governor says
Gov. Bob Ferguson says the extent of the damage in Washington state is profound but unclear after more than a week of heavy rains and record flooding.
With roads such as Highway 2 — set to be closed for months — severely damaged or blocked by debris, crews are working 24 hours a day to assess and plan repairs.
